Haley Ward is seeking a highly motivated and skilled Solid Waste Engineer to join our team. The Solid Waste Engineer will be responsible for designing and implementing waste management systems, ensuring compliance with regulations, and providing technical expertise in waste disposal and recycling. This role requires strong problem-solving abilities and a deep understanding of waste management principles.
